Dozens of protesters took to the streets of Elizabeth City for an 8th consecutive day, following the police shooting of Andrew Brown. Despite demonstrations remaining entirely peaceful, police arrested several participants and stopped the protest with dozens of militarized officers on the scene.

Around 100 protesters gathered at the Portland ICE facility on Holocaust Remembrance Day, setting up a memorial for those who have and are facing genocide, and burning American flags. DHS then assaulted demonstrators with munitions after they set a dumpster on fire, with several waves occurring of law enforcement retreating and coming back out, before they were pushed out one last time by the remaining protesters and the demonstration ended for the night.
Italian leftists protested in Saronno, Lombardy, demanding the halting of public health care cuts that the province’s government has been committing to for the past decades. The crowd also condemned cuts to the pay of private-sector workers and exposure to COVID-19 that students face.
Hundreds of protesters in Paris marched in opposition to Islamophobia and a Separatism Law being proposed in the French government, which would greatly increase the powers of the state to carry out surveillance on political and religious minorities under the guise of preventing radicalization.
Dozens of protesters gathered in Villavicencio, demanding an immediate end to healthcare privatization and police violence amid a general strike in Colombia. Police attacked the peaceful demonstration with a water cannon, dispersing the crowd which later came back together.
